Bay fronted terraced 3 bed period property with modern and impressive kitchen/breakfast room, spacious utility, south facing lounge/diner with a low maintenance rear garden. The property is only a short level walk into town and is available with NO ONWARD CHAIN.

Lime Grove is a well located residential street, a handy and almost level walk to the town centre, shops and picturesque quayside. Also being a wide thoroughfare provides for generous unrestricted parking.

SERVICES: Mains water, electricity, gas and drainage. uPVC double glazed windows and gas fired central heating.

COUNCIL TAX: Band B

DIRECTIONS TO FIND: From Bideford Quay proceed up Bridgeland Street, veering right at the top and continuing to the end of North Road. At the junction continue straight across into Lime Grove whereupon the property will be found towards the end on the right-hand side displaying its number and a BRIGHTS For Sale board.

The accommodation is at present arranged to provide (measurements are approximate) :-

ENTRANCE PORCH: Tessellated tiled flooring, uPVC obscure double glazed door into:

HALL: Stairs to first floor, radiator, understairs cupboard and fitted carpet.

LOUNGE/DINER: 7.88m into bay x 3.46m max Bay window with fitted venetian blinds, boarded fireplace with wooden mantle piece and slate hearth.
Attractive coving/ceiling rose, 2 radiators and fitted carpet.

KITCHEN/BREAKFAST ROOM: 4.97m x 4.62m max Working surface incorporating one and half bowl single drainer stainless sink unit, 5 ring gas hob with extractor above and eye level double oven and integrated microwave adjacent. Central breakfast bar with velux window and uPVC double glazed French doors opening onto the rear garden. Integrated dishwasher, cupboards, drawers with matching
wall units. Radiator and vinyl flooring.

UTILITY: 2.78m max x 2.63m Working surface incorporating belfast sink, space/plumbing for washing machine and tumble dryer. Cupboards and drawers, radiator, wall mounted Worcester combi boiler and vinyl flooring. uPVC double glazed
door into the rear garden.

CLOAKROOM: Low level WC.

STAIRS & LANDING: Balustrade staircase, access to front and back loft space. Radiator and fitted carpet.

BEDROOM 1: 4.73m x 3.45m South facing room with 2 windows to the front, decorative cast iron fireplace, radiator and fitted carpet.

BEDROOM 2: 3.71m x 2.94m Decorative cast iron fireplace, radiator and fitted carpet.

SHOWER ROOM: Fully tiled shower cubicle with overhead and body spray shower, low level dual flush WC, wash basin and fully tiled walls. Tiled flooring.

BEDROOM 3: 2.85m x 2.56m Radiator and fitted carpet.

OUTSIDE: To the front of the property is a small recessed frontage perfect for bin storage or a small flower bed. The REAR GARDEN comprises a small yard accessed via the kitchen with outside cold water tap and steps leading to the large low maintenance DECKING 9.25m x 4.41m

(fitted November 2019) with the attractive original stone wall to the rear and having outside electric sockets.
